Know your optionsWhen you create lessons or assignments, you have the following options to create: Assignment, Material, Topic, or Reuse Post. Explain the differences between them and how they work. You can respond in text here or link to a Doc where you prepared your answer. More Info |
Post assignment & understand consequencesUse any Slide, Form, or Doc that asks questions. Each student should have their own copy. For evidence, explain why it is important to make a copy for each student and what happens if you don't. More Info |
Managing commentsManage the chit chat in the class. Change the students' ability to comment to "Only Teacher Can post or Comment". Upload picture of this for evidence. (Make sure you learn how to delete unnecessary/hurtful comments if you do not use this feature). More Info |
Reuse postsIf you haven't done this yet, please do! No need to create an assignment for each period, each Google Classroom. Create it once, then later Create>Reuse Post>choose the Classroom from which you posted the item first. Edit anything that needs changing. Voila! Time saver! Explain your use of this. More Info |
Rookie mistakesExplain when to use the announcement feature and when to click on Classwork. More Info |
